CLEVELAND, Ohio — A shocking incident has emerged in a Cleveland neighborhood, where two children, aged 9 and 10, are facing serious allegations related to the violent assault of a 5-year-old girl. The incident, which unfolded last month, has drawn wide attention from authorities and the community alike.
Cuyahoga County prosecutors have filed charges against the two young suspects, including attempted murder, kidnapping, and rape. These charges mark a disturbing case that highlights issues surrounding child behavior and community safety. The children were reportedly involved in the attack while the victim was under the care of a family member.
According to the victim’s mother, Antavia Kennibrew, her daughter was last seen safe when she was dropped off at a relative’s home on September 13. However, the 5-year-old managed to leave the premises and was soon subjected to a brutal beating by a group of kids outside. Kennibrew recounted the harrowing moment she discovered her daughter receiving medical attention just a few blocks away.
“What I saw was unimaginable,” Kennibrew stated, describing the scene. “Her hair was torn from her scalp. She was covered in bruises. Blood was everywhere, including her eyes and mouth. Her fingers were caked with dirt and debris.”
Due to the sensitive nature of the case, and the age of the suspects, further details about the attack have not been disclosed by law enforcement. The gravity of the situation raises difficult questions about the influences that lead to such extreme behavior among children.
Kennibrew expressed her concerns about the long-lasting impact of the attack on her daughter. “I just want her to feel like a normal 5-year-old again,” she said. In the aftermath, the little girl has begun therapy to cope with the trauma.
